  • Patent number: 9538672
    Abstract: Disclosed herein are nanoscale devices comprising one or more ferroelectric nanoshells characterized as having an extreme curvature in at least one spatial dimension. Also disclosed are ferroelectric field effect transistors and metal ferroelectric metal capacitors comprising one or more ferroelectric nanoshells. Methods for controlling spontaneous ferroelectric polarization in nanoshell devices are also disclosed.
    Type: Grant
    Filed: September 28, 2015
    Date of Patent: January 3, 2017
    Assignee: Drexel University
    Inventors: Jonathan E Spanier, Stephen S Nonnenmann, Oren David Leaffer
